Welcome! SXULLS tells the story of Germany’s best scullers and their dream of the Olympic Games. Join the athletes until Tokyo 2020!

Prolog

15 German scullers, 3 boat classes and only 7 seats available. The young scullers have a long and hard way ahead of them. Who will make it into which boat and fulfill his dream of the Olympic Games?

The long way to Tokyo

2019

Single scull is taken – who will make in one of the other boats?

In Duisburg the preliminary decision for the double scull has fallen. How will the coaches decide?

The team is selected – nine athletes are nominated for the European Championships in Lucerne

Rowing European Championships – in Lucerne (Switzerland) the team has to prove itself for the first time internationally

World Rowing Cup III – the dress rehearsal for the World Cup will take place in Rotterdam (Netherlands)

Training Camps – in Weißensee (Austria) and Munich will be working on fine tuning for the World Championchips

Rowing World Championship – the season’s highlight! In Linz (Austria) the boats have to be qualified for TOKYO 2020

First training 2020 – the Olympic season begins and the tickets are redistributed
